Also called the doumbek, the Moroccan Darbouka is a single-head drum. It is played held under the arm, or held sideways on the lap. Variations of this drum are found across North Africa and the Middle East. Size: 9'' diameter x 15” height (Due to the handmade nature of this drum, size and color may vary).
